About This Item

Archibald Constable. 1900. Six volumes (including index volume) published 1900-1914. Plates & maps, some coloured, some folding. Folio (12 1/2 x 9 inches), original red cloth gilt, top edges gilt others uncut. Spines of vols. 1 & 2 dulled, vol. 3 spine snagged. Overall good. Weight 14.280 kg thus extra postage will be requested.
